Analysis

Americas: Lower-middle income recorded 767,451 for total weekly hours worked of employed persons in 2027. That is the highest value across all 23 years on record.

That represents a change of up 1.9% on the previous year and up 23.4% over ten years.

Over the whole period, total weekly hours worked of employed persons in Americas: Lower-middle income peaked at 767,451 in 2027 and was at its lowest, 460,909, in 2005.

Americas: Lower-middle income ranks 76th of 87 groups on this measure, in the bottom quarter.

The long-run direction has been consistently rising across the 23 years of available data.

Total weekly hours worked of employed persons in Americas: Lower-middle income, year by year

Annual values for Total weekly hours worked of employed persons (ILO modelled estimates) in Americas: Lower-middle income, 2005 to 2027.
Year Value Change
2005 460,909
2006 472,326 +2.5%
2007 487,545 +3.2%
2008 492,581 +1.0%
2009 503,527 +2.2%
2010 515,462 +2.4%
2011 534,412 +3.7%
2012 548,456 +2.6%
2013 561,713 +2.4%
2014 586,307 +4.4%
2015 597,525 +1.9%
2016 613,317 +2.6%
2017 622,031 +1.4%
2018 645,644 +3.8%
2019 659,076 +2.1%
2020 600,133 -8.9%
2021 670,294 +11.7%
2022 685,756 +2.3%
2023 703,768 +2.6%
2024 723,320 +2.8%
2025 738,048 +2.0%
2026 752,814 +2.0%
2027 767,451 +1.9%

Imputed observations are not based on national data, are subject to high uncertainty and should not be used for country comparisons or rankings.This series is based on the 13th ICLS definitions. This indicator refers to total weekly hours actually worked of employed persons in their main job. For more information, refer to the ILO Modelled Estimates (ILOEST) database description.
